Output 8c1c28faae908bcab5644da406b169eaebe01931a8ec1d9c0e3e16e080cbb5ff:0

value
3519554
script pubkey
OP_0 OP_PUSHBYTES_20 a509168931d1c697db04109536c63778f32bb629
address
bc1q55y3dzf368rf0kcyzz2nd33h0rejhd3fs74qzs
transaction
8c1c28faae908bcab5644da406b169eaebe01931a8ec1d9c0e3e16e080cbb5ff
confirmations
1679
spent
false